re: 开发人员为什么要支持非IE浏览器的四个故事 Brian Sun 2009-03-26 09:22
@todd
1. 请问哪里不现实?请说出不现实的地方来,或者给几个更现实的例子。
2. 请问文中哪里提到“放弃IE”了??
re: 再谈谈Mozilla Brian Sun 2009-03-26 09:20
@Jacky-Q
你不知道Chrome被称为“云终端”吗?末尾喊巨口号不给啊??
re: 再谈谈Mozilla Brian Sun 2009-03-26 09:18
@Mijia
没错。Firefox就是XULRunner。只不过3.0以前版本是private using。3.0以后版本才可以借用XULRunner in Firefox installation。
所以说Firefox的成功也是跟商业模式的转变有关系的。
re: 再谈谈Mozilla Brian Sun 2009-03-26 09:15
@thinkind
1. Opera应该算是行业内的前辈了,老牌浏览器厂商,我听说没有IE就已经有Opera了。但是就像我说的,IE/Safari/Chrome它们生来富贵,花不完的钱,而Opera不仅要跟上大公司脚步,还要想办法自己挣钱,多不容易啊。Opera其实是没有影响力的,但是因为历史原因,很多设计师在设计网页时都考虑了Opera。这是Opera的优势,应该好好利用,好好活着。
2. 两句都说对了。Maxthon当然有前途,不过它确实也是俗不可耐。打开安徽卫视,没有一个节目不俗的,不是照样省级卫视第一吗?Maxthon的战略是自己不做浏览器内核,通过增强易用性取悦用户,这样的做法是很有前途的,不过要看Maxthon今后发展能否把握。
re: Eclipse在做什么 Brian Sun 2007-04-21 09:49
是这样吗?我们公司的所有程序员都在用RCP开发,他们中最慢的一个人也只花了半天就上手了,RCP并不难,而且有大量的文档,要善于用Google啊。。。
即使我们中对平台、IDE和编程语言的使用存在分歧,我也能理解你的观点,但我不能理解这个世界上为什么会有VJ#.NET这样的烂东西,我曾被迫在VJ#下开发,写了15行程序就已经受不了了,因为我不能重构!不能方便对一个类提取本地化字符串。我不能找到整个项目对一个方法的全部调用。另一个同事用C#不能调用我写的代码(因为一个包名叫internal!)。最终我不得不放弃VJ#。最终我听说原来微软的员工也用SourceInsight。
re: 可视化思考 Brian Sun 2007-04-18 23:23
软件行业的革命往往率先从软件行业本身的工具开始,可视化的开发早就改变了世界,只是至今还不是主流,看看MDA的发展吧。
re: Eclipse在做什么 Brian Sun 2007-04-18 23:21
好的,请等我的下一篇Blog,尽快献上。
re: 芒果软件XMIND 2007 Brian Sun 2007-01-23 20:38
BeanSoft说的非常有道理,我们也是这样考虑的。。。
直接在Arguments里面填:
/e,/select,${workspace_loc}${resource_path}
不就行了,哈哈~~
re: 芒果软件XMIND 2007 Brian Sun 2007-01-17 20:37
有两个产品可以比较一下:
一个是FreeMind,开源产品,就软件的易用性和功能而言,FreeMind做的远不如XMIND,而且XMIND主要是面向商业用户的。
另一个是MindManager,商业产品,XMIND在易用性、性能、跨平台性、导出功能等很多方面也比它出色。
另外,XMIND同时支持上面两个产品的文件格式。
XMIND还在发展中,将来还会有很多新功能加入。XMIND力求做一款专业的可视化思维工具,希望得到大家的支持!谢谢!
re: AspectJ初探 Brian Sun 2006-12-14 18:03
你用的自动反编译工具是什么?呵呵,也想搞个玩玩。
re: 芒果软件实验室 诚揽人才 Brian Sun 2006-09-19 17:02
谢谢hbifts,FreeMind确实做的很不错,但是有易用性的问题,MindManager是模仿Office语境和风格的产品,是一个强大而值得重视的竞争对手,但是我们比他们做的专业,至于其它的商业产品,如JetMind或NovaMind,仔细看就会发现我们在市场细分上还是有很大不同的,况且他们做的都不如MindManager。
re: 芒果软件实验室 诚揽人才 Brian Sun 2006-09-10 11:12
谢谢!
确实都在忙这件事情,所以写Blog的时间太少了,以致于从年初到现在只写过一篇~~
re: 诚拦人才(北京) Brian Sun 2006-08-07 23:27
不是不透露,是因为公司还没有成立,所以很多信息都没有,你想知道什么就问吧。
re: Web2.0的时代到来了吗? Brian Sun 2006-03-10 12:14
“Web2.0火了,我们又多了一条路”?
昨日才于一位朋友谈起此事。
我所要表达的意思非常简单,Web2.0在用一个简单的工具箱企图做一些复杂的事情,相比RIA,它必然不会太有用;后者(或者是被很多人称为Rich Browser的东东)事实上是在用复杂的工具箱做一些简单的事情。我认为人类总的发展趋势在于后者。
一个优秀的投资者应该同时拥有自己的明星、现金牛和稳定的大盘至少三个投资组合。所以我更愿意相信RIA和传统软件业。Web2.0并未给我们多带来一条路,却给我们在原来的投资组合中添加了一种元素的机会。
是啊,可是如果在奥运会中因为靶子上面有个洞而输掉比赛岂不是很冤?如果是你,我相信你一定会为枪卡壳而气愤的。
贱人!居然玩这种游戏!偶才不完呢。。。。。(过年回来让你好好orz一把!)
两个美国人去非洲卖鞋。。。天哪,这么土的故事还要我再讲一遍吗。。。一个人发现非洲人不穿鞋,所以灰头土脸的回来了,另一个人发现非洲人居然全都没有鞋穿,于是发了大财回来。。。
到底是“中国还不是很富裕。。。这也是没有办法的事情”,还是“中国不富裕。。。所以我们有很多办法做事情”?富裕不富裕不是你做不做一件正确的事情的理由,无论何时何地,每个人都有选择自己态度的权力。
如果我创业出来做软件,我的软件一定支持苹果电脑的操作系统!
呵呵,我遇到这种情况只有把打印机连上一台Windows,然后上网打印,无奈啊。
请把“好素质”解释一遍,如果您的意思是我太容易被人欺骗了所以没有“好素质”的话,我的确是!
“选错了环境”??!!你去论坛上看看,难道那么多人都选错了环境??!!难道只要是学生就选错了环境??!!怎么样的情况才能算是“配置都达到标准”?瓶颈并不是在我这一端啊。。。。
我承认我抱怨时我是站在自己的角度,可是有很多人跟我的角度是一样的。
我从不“光走技术路线”,但我也从不声称“放弃走技术路线”!!
是啊,游戏规则是要遵守,可是游戏规则本身是不公平的,我无意中参加了一个不公平的游戏,玩输了,难道不能抱怨一下吗?
re: 由ATM机的变化引发的思考 Brian Sun 2005-12-13 11:22
不会吧,比吐硬币还恶劣的情况。。。
re: 关于个体软件过程 Brian Sun 2005-12-13 11:21
?
我是很想自己写的,但是输入法最重要的是字库和词库啊。
re: 申请团队Blog Brian Sun 2005-12-09 10:53
英文名:Eclipse Hackers Team
中文名:Eclipse骇客帝国
简洁:专注于开发Eclipse插件和研究Eclipse体系结构,并把好的思想带给国内同行。
团队成员的Blog帐号:briansun, xdingding, fhawk, reloadcn
re: 关于UI的不同解释 Brian Sun 2005-11-24 13:55
读读自己8个月前写的文章,也挺有意思的,知道现在我还是要经常跟别人解释一下“我们所说的UI不是同一个意思”,但是比较一下,还是自己3月份的时候概括的比较好,复习一下。
UI泡泡
re: 测试驱动开发全功略 Brian Sun 2005-11-24 09:56
说的是啊,所以我们要致力于改善国内软件界的这个状况。:)
re: 由ATM机的变化引发的思考 Brian Sun 2005-11-24 09:49
呵呵,你学上的怎么样啊,有没有什么大的长进?如果有的话我就建议你做些小的作品拿到网上来,偶帮你推销推销,呵呵。
re: 由ATM机的变化引发的思考 Brian Sun 2005-11-23 10:48
1。国外有很多ATM机是盲人可以使用的,很多场合(比如商场或24H银行)都是一排通用ATM里有一个是全语音提示的,还有一个是位置低的(便于坐轮椅的人使用)。
2。如果这样说的话眼睛也没有休息因为做梦能看到很多东西说明视神经并没有休息,只是眼球不转罢了。
TO FRANK:你小子不好好上学在干吗?
re: 平台相关性与平台无关性 Brian Sun 2005-11-22 13:14
weide,没问题,呵呵,谢谢捧场!
re: 关于隐喻 Brian Sun 2005-11-22 13:12
什么复出了?我一直没歇着啊。。。
re: 由ATM机的变化引发的思考 Brian Sun 2005-11-22 13:10
To Frank!!!!:::
1。我参加的世界可用性大会,会上绝对不可以提出什么意见是残疾人不能使用的!
2。我睡觉的时候,耳朵会休息。
re: 南京Starbucks的怪现象 Brian Sun 2005-11-22 11:29
太远了,我在上地,推荐一个近一点的吧。把具体的名字告诉我,呵呵。
re: 由ATM机的变化引发的思考 Brian Sun 2005-11-20 01:47
To Flair@ZJU,你不希望改阿,我也不希望改也!可是我得到的可靠消息是——全世界都在改!还是我说的那句话,在这个领域安全性的优先级要远高于易用性!
To www_1,你有数据吗?
re: 由ATM机的变化引发的思考 Brian Sun 2005-11-18 15:20
事实上,我是不同意这种方式的,因为丢钱的问题解决了,而丢卡的问题却没有解决,而且增加了用户的动作,不过金融行业不担心这个,安全性总是比易用性排在更高的等级。
re: 平台相关性与平台无关性 Brian Sun 2005-11-17 22:13
对于一个社会而言,总成本和总效率是成反比的。通常作为一个指标出现,原文是笔误了。
re: 平台相关性与平台无关性 Brian Sun 2005-11-17 15:28
这个例子有些公司内部的技术细节不便于透露,但是只能说为了迁就.NET的一些特征,该系统只能在Windows上运行。
至于“平台无关”,我已经说过了它是相对的概念,你怎么描述你的产品是平台无关的呢,“芯片无关”?“操作系统无关”?还是“运行平台无关”?
可能是我思路常常跳跃的缘故,也可能是很多浏览网页或订阅RSS的人只读文章的一半的缘故,您没能理解我的意思。
re: 测试驱动开发全功略 Brian Sun 2005-11-16 16:06
首先您做任何代码都应该有个期望的结果,如果结果是随机的(这种情况很少),那么测试用例就是判别结果是否随机即可;如果结果是确定的,也就是说有对错之分,那么测试用例就判断结果的对错,这是个非常简单的原则,但是可以作为TDD的第一原则。
至于您问的有些专业的问题,我认为是测试用例以何种技术编写和执行的问题,我没怎么接触过底层的代码,所以真的不知道该给您怎样的建议。至于复杂的数据结构,但愿它们可以获得重用,如果不能重用,那也值得写一个模拟真实的数据结构去测试,否则复杂永远是复杂的,而测试迟早要人去做。
例子是Eclipse,它是一个IDE,因此它要测试一个复杂的软件项目能否很正确的编译,它就写了一个生成项目内容的程序来测,并且觉得非常值得。
我订阅的RSS不知为何过滤了您的评论,非常抱歉没能及时回复,希望您能原谅,并继续支持爬树的泡泡,呵呵。
泡泡
re: 关于隐喻 Brian Sun 2005-11-16 11:04
我叫Brian,不是Brain,呜呜。。。前者是英美常见姓名,后者是“大脑”。。。
最后抱怨一句中国式软件的风格,谁也承担不起简单的责任。。。。。。
re: 关于隐喻 Brian Sun 2005-11-15 23:35
呵呵,不算是什么老鸟,今年有几篇文章被一些国内学术网站收录,所以看的人多了些。
最近忙了点,很久没有写东西了,怪对不起大家的,以后补偿,哈哈。
正版也不贵啊,拜托,哥们,支持一下正版吧,我最近刚听了成龙的支持正版的动员演讲,呵呵。
泡泡
re: 关于洞穴寓言的几部电影 Brian Sun 2005-09-28 22:33
嗯,<<灵异村庄>>确实可以算一部,呵呵。
re: 用例还是用案 Brian Sun 2005-09-28 22:09
我不幸的告诉大家,为了保持整个学术界的译法尽量统一,我仍然建议大家把use case翻译为“用例”!
re: 也谈天下归一 Brian Sun 2005-09-28 22:07
AOP和AOSD在某些人的圈子里很热,但是在主流程序员心里还没什么地位,呵呵。
re: 南京Starbucks的怪现象 Brian Sun 2005-09-28 22:04
也许吧,但我觉得这和管理没有关系,作为人类经营和管理最优秀的企业之一,Starbucks的某些现象应当来源于整个社会的精神面貌。
re: 有没有可能以开源软件为平台建构ERP? Brian Sun 2005-09-14 14:53
探讨一下嘛,做人何必那么认真呢。。。。。。哈哈